1. Explore the Oneida Community Mansion House
The Oneida Community Mansion House is a fascinating glimpse into the history of a unique religious group. Built in the mid-19th century, this large structure served as the home for the Oneida Community, known for its progressive ideas on communal living. Visitors can explore the beautifully restored rooms and learn about the community’s innovative practices, such as communal parenting and shared ownership.
Guided tours provide in-depth information about the lives of the people who once inhabited this mansion. You will find impressive architectural features that reflect the period’s style. The mansion also hosts special events throughout the year, further enhancing its historical significance.
The grounds surrounding the mansion offer picturesque views and a pleasant environment for leisurely strolls. You can take in the lush gardens that showcase plants once cultivated by the community. This creates a serene backdrop for photographs and relaxation.
Learning about the Oneida Community is insightful and enlightening. This exploration allows visitors to reflect on the values of cooperation and equality in daily living. The mansion embodies the spirit of a time when ideals were put into practice.

10. Participate in Local Events During Maple Weekends
Maple Weekends are a delightful tradition in Oneida County every March. This event celebrates the rich history of maple syrup production in the region. It’s a fun experience for everyone, including families, friends, and food lovers.
During Maple Weekends, local sugarhouses open their doors to visitors for tours and tastings. You can watch the sap being collected and hear stories about the syrup-making process. Many sugarhouses also offer delicious samples of fresh maple syrup over pancakes or waffles.
Participating in the festivities provides an engaging and educational experience. Events may include live demonstrations, arts and crafts for children, and opportunities to buy local products. This creates a festive atmosphere where you can connect with the community.

14. Explore Fort Stanwix National Monument
Fort Stanwix National Monument is a must-visit historical site located in Rome, New York. This reconstructed fort serves as a testament to its strategic importance during the Revolutionary War. Visitors can take immersive tours that transport them back in time to 18th-century life.
The fort features living history demonstrations that depict daily activities of soldiers and settlers. You can engage with staff dressed in period costumes who share stories and demonstrations of lifeways, weapons, and tactics used during the era. This interactive experience makes history come alive!
Wandering through the fort, you will witness the architecture and layout of military structures. Learn about the role the fort played in American history and its efforts to secure the region.
The surrounding grounds offer scenic walking paths and picnic areas. Enjoy a leisurely stroll while appreciating the beautiful landscapes that frame the monument. The fort itself provides stunning views from its walls.
Fort Stanwix is an exceptional educational outing for anyone interested in American history.
